This winter and despite the difficult circumstances, Om Sleiman Farm is launching the second edition of its CSA Agroecology Internship, a hands-on training program that will provide three Palestinians with fully funded scholarships to learn agroecology through both theory and daily practice at the farm and in nearby projects.
Over 9 weeks during October and November, participants will immerse themselves in every aspect of running a small-scale agroecological farm. They will learn directly from the Om Sleiman team alongside experienced farmers and practitioners from Palestine and abroad.
The internship is designed for Palestinians who want to deepen their understanding of agroecology, gain practical farming skills, and explore farming as a long-term livelihood. It also serves as a pathway for future team members to join Om Sleiman Farm and strengthen the growing agroecology movement in Palestine.

Why This Matters?
For generations, Palestinians relied on their land and the agricultural seasons to feed their communities. Farming was not only a source of food but also a way of life, with knowledge passed from one generation to the next.
Today, military colonial occupation—including land confiscation, restricted access to water and resources, and ongoing violence against farmers—has made farming increasingly difficult. As the farming community shrinks, valuable agricultural knowledge is at risk of being lost.
At the same time, there are almost no opportunities in Palestine for young people to receive, whether paid or unpaid, hands-on training in agroecology. This internship helps bridge that gap by preserving knowledge, training a new generation of farmers, and strengthening Palestine's food sovereignty.
Your support will fund three full scholarships, covering accommodation, meals, transportation, training, and a modest stipend so participants can fully dedicate themselves to learning.

What Participants Will Experience
Interns will work alongside the farm team four days a week, gaining hands-on experience in the daily realities of running a Community Supported Agriculture (CSA) farm. Each week, they will also participate in theoretical workshops and visit other farms and community projects to exchange knowledge and learn from diverse agroecological practices.
Throughout the internship, participants will learn about:
Seed saving and the different type of seeds
Crop planning and seasonal production
Composting and soil health
Natural fertilizers and ecological pest management
Plant propagation and cultivation
Tree care and food forest design
Harvesting and post-harvest handling
Farm planning and management
Community Supported Agriculture (CSA)
And many other topics related to agroecology and small-scale regenerative farming.
